0

I am trying to create an attribute which can be repeated any number of times for a page. I am wondering how I can implement something like this with Magento attributes.

For example on the page there would be a text box and an add another button and on the template I could get an array of the lines of text submitted.

5
  • For which entity (product, page, etc.)?
    – benmarks
    Commented Jul 22, 2014 at 21:12
  • How would these values be used? Would they need to be filtered or sorted on?
    – benmarks
    Commented Jul 22, 2014 at 21:15
  • no just displayed on screen as links. would be an icon, a link, and text determined by three associated fields for each link and on screen a list of links one after the other.
    – lathomas64
    Commented Jul 22, 2014 at 21:33
  • Attributes in Magento are always associated with an entity. Which entity? Or are these just content blocks which will show in any context?
    – benmarks
    Commented Jul 23, 2014 at 12:44
  • missed the first question about which entity. for a product. In this case products may have 0..* links associated with them and I wanted to use attributes to fill in values for the link(text, destination, css class etc.)
    – lathomas64
    Commented Jul 23, 2014 at 13:29

1 Answer 1

1

You could do this with an attribute having a textarea for its frontend input and then a custom frontend model for rendering which would read the linebreaks as a value delimiter.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.